你想打造一个令人惊艳的网站吗?从零开始,一步步掌握网站设计的核心流程
想象你站在一片空白画布前,手中握着画笔,眼前是无限的可能性。你渴望创造一个能够吸引眼球、传递信息的网站,一个真正属于你自己的数字空间。但面对陌生的代码、复杂的设计工具和模糊的概念,你是否感到有些迷茫?别担心,今天,我们就将带你深入探索网站设计的每一个环节,让你像一位经验丰富的设计师一样,从容应对挑战,最终呈现出一个完美的作品。
第一步:明确目标与定位,为你的网站奠定基础
在动笔之前,你必须先问自己几个关键问题:这个网站是为了什么而建?你的目标受众是谁?你希望通过这个网站实现什么?这些问题看似简单,却直接决定了你后续的设计方向。比如,如果你要创建一个电商网站,那么用户体验、产品展示和支付流程就是重中之重;而如果是个人博客,内容呈现和互动性则更为关键。
以知名电商网站亚马逊为例,它的设计核心在于“便捷购物”。从首页的导航栏到商品详情页的布局,再到购物车的交互设计,每一个细节都围绕着“让用户轻松找到并购买心仪商品”这一目标展开。反观一些个人博客,它们往往更注重内容的深度和原创性,页面设计简洁明快,便于读者沉浸式阅读。
明确目标与定位后,你还需要进行市场调研,分析竞争对手的网站,找出他们的优缺点,从而为自己的设计提供参考。记住,没有完美的设计,只有最适合你需求的设计。
一旦你明确了目标,接下来就是规划网站的结构与布局。这就像盖房子,你需要先画出蓝图,确定各个房间的位置和功能。在网站设计中,这通常通过创建网站地图(Sitemap)来实现。网站地图是一个树状结构图,展示了网站的主要页面和它们之间的层级关系。
以一个典型的企业官网为例,它的网站地图可能包括:首页、关于我们、产品服务、新闻资讯、联系我们等一级页面,以及各个一级页面下的二级、三级页面。这样的结构清晰,用户可以轻松找到所需信息。
在布局方面,你需要考虑页面的整体框架、元素排列和视觉流向。常见的布局方式有:栅格布局、流式布局、固定布局等。栅格布局将页面划分为多个单元格,每个单元格可以独立调整大小,适合需要精确控制元素位置的页面;流式布局则根据浏览器窗口大小动态调整元素大小,适合响应式设计。
以设计一个新闻网站为例,它的首页通常采用栅格布局,将新闻文章分为多个列,每个列展示不同的内容模块,如头条新闻、热点推荐、视频报道等。这样的布局既美观又实用,能够快速吸引用户的注意力。
布局确定后,就是时候为网站添加视觉元素了。这包括颜色搭配、字体选择、图片和图标的设计等。视觉元素不仅决定了网站的整体风格,还影响着用户的浏览体验。
颜色搭配是网站设计中最直观的部分。不同的颜色能够传递不同的情感和信息。比如,蓝色通常代表着专业和信任,适合用于企业官网;而红色则充满活力,适合用于促销页面。在配色时,你需要考虑主色、辅色和点缀色的搭配,确保整体和谐统一。
以一个儿童教育网站为例,它的主色调可能是明亮的黄色或绿色,辅以蓝色和白色,营造出活泼、温馨的氛围。而字体选择同样重要。不同的字体风格能够传递不同的情感。比如,黑体字显得简洁有力,适合用于标题;而宋体字则显得优雅细腻,适合用于正文。
图片和图标是网站视觉元素中的亮点。高质量的图片能够吸引用户的注意力,传递丰富的信息。而精心设计的图标则能够简化操作,提升用户体验。以一个电商平台为例,它的商品详情页通常会展示多张高清图片,让用户能够全面了解商品;而购物车图标则用简洁的线条表示,用户一眼就能找到。
设计稿完成之后,就是开发与测试阶段。这一步将你的创意转化为实际的网站。开发通常分为前端开发和后端开发两个部分。前端开发负责网站的界面和交互,后端开发负责网站的数据处理和逻辑。
前端开发主要使用HTML、CSS和JavaScript等技术。HTML负责构建网页的结构,CSS负责美化网页的样式,JavaScript负责实现网页的交互功能。以一个简单的登录页面为例,HTML构建了登录表单的结构,CSS设置了表单的样式,JavaScript则负责验证用户输入的信息。
后端开发则更加复杂,需要使用服务器端语言(如PHP、Python、Java等)和数据库技术。后端开发负责处理用户提交的数据,与数据库进行交互,并返回相应的结果。以一个电商网站为例,当用户提交订单